Gravitational antenna with non tuned resonant transducer
Abstract
The dynamic response of a gravitational antenna with resonant transducer is analyzed. The case in which the transducer is not tuned to the antenna is considered. Expressions for the signal, noise and critical temperature of the system are found from the responses to both modes. The analysis shows that the limit operation temperature is half in the case of nontuned transducer as it is possible to work at only one of the two modes while for tuned transducer the limit is four times the noise temperature.
